This class series encompasses positions that perform a broad range of professional and technical work involving but not limited to: cultural/natural resource assessment, programming, funding, evaluation, survey, inventory, preservation, research, education, planning, mitigation and recovery.
This position works as the Community Arts Development Coordinator for the Department of Tourism and Cultural Affairs' Nevada Arts Council Division and is located in Carson City, NV. In consultation with the Executive Director, the incumbent develops and coordinates short and long-term programs, services and partnerships to serve local arts agencies, communities and community-based arts organizations to strengthen and enhance community vitality and access to the arts for residents. This position is also responsible for planning and coordinating arts town meetings, conferences and workshops; providing guidance to constituents applying for grants; production of the agency newsletter, writing articles and publications; fund development for program activities; and assisting with other program activities agency and department wide. The ideal candidate shall possess the following knowledge and/or experience: familiarity with the mission and goals of a state arts agency and of the National Endowment for the Arts; development, administration and evaluation of programs designed to support local arts agencies and community cultural organizations; broad knowledge of artistic disciplines; sensitivity to the needs of a wide variety of nonprofit organizations, ranging from emerging to established.
In order to be qualified, you must meet the following requirements:
|
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university in studio art, dance, theater, photography, folklife, communications, architecture, English, creative writing or related field and one year of professional level experience which involved general arts administration, management of an arts program, folklore studies, or comparable experience in a public or non-profit setting; OR graduation from high school or equivalent education and two years of professional experience relevant to the position which involved working with a non-profit arts or cultural organization, a public arts or cultural agency, or comparable experience in a public or non-profit setting; managing and administrating arts programs and grants; OR an equivalent combination of education and experience; OR one year of experience as a Cultural/Natural Resource Specialist I in Nevada State service. |
|
Experience with database management and various software programs, including Microsoft Access, Word, Excel and Outlook is required.
